SOC 220 - Forensic Evidence

Institution:
Lebanon Valley College
Subject:
Description:
This course involves the application of scientific methods to solving crimes. The course will explore the many ways in which an offender leaves evidence behind at a crime scene and carries evidence away from that crime scene. A range of topics will be covered including, but not limited to: ballistics, DNA, Fingerprints, tire prints, odontology and entomology. Prerequisite: SOC 110. 3 credits.
